Output 36bf39eb8d7c49b5dea25835762126f2f2ca61cb2d97ac945f33ba8d766007f5:5

value
20897336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fc3a5c22e6ec994d9fd90c2938ea774cba14afb OP_EQUAL
address
MJ67cYq37GqC1PbwPrtgiuWHB4EfoEkWVp
transaction
36bf39eb8d7c49b5dea25835762126f2f2ca61cb2d97ac945f33ba8d766007f5
spent
true